Women With ADD - Symptoms and Diagnosis
Women who suffer from ADD have to deal with daily challenges into adulthood. Women who suffer from ADD may have trouble meeting their family's demands regardless of whether they are a bit distracted in school or struggle to complete household chores. Symptoms are different for women and opposite to the more common signs in men, which means the diagnosis and treatment process can be difficult.
Symptoms

This is especially the case during hormonal changes like menopausal changes, puberty or PMS. Depression is not a sign of however, it is often associated with ADD and is often misdiagnosed when doctors look for signs that are more typical of men. Women with the hyperactive/impulsive subtype of ADD are impatient visibly or internally, jump into activities without thinking and speak and act impulsively. Small irritations such as standing in line or waiting for the phone cause them to fall into distraction. They also struggle with time management, forgetfulness, and a difficult time concentrating on their tasks. They might also have a tendency to fidget and sleep in a poor way. They could be susceptible to anxiety and depression, which are often misdiagnosed as bipolar disorders.
Diagnosis
Since the symptoms of women with ADD are less recognized than the men's, it can be difficult to get diagnosed. Doctors tend to concentrate on certain symptoms that are more prevalent for boys, and overlook the subtleties when it comes to ADD in girls. This is particularly relevant during menopausal cycles, puberty, perimenopause, and PMS, when estrogen levels decrease.
